Pembina Hills School Division invites applications for the position of Program and Bus Assistant, R.F. Staples Secondary School.The DivisionPembina Hills School Division provides education to approximately 3800 students in 15 community schools in north central Alberta. PHSD also provides education to over 10,000 students from within and beyond our borders through our online school Vista Virtual School, as well as many students enrolled with other divisions across the province receiving service through the Alberta Distance Learning Centre. For more information on our remarkable Division, please visit our website at www.pembinahills.caThe School - R. F. Staples Secondary School (Grades 7 - 12)"Work Hard, Be Kind"Our aim is to deliver an education program with continued support from parents and our community. We are dedicated to the personal and academic development of our students as contributing members of society. At R. F. Staples, located in Westlock, Alberta, approximately 90 km northwest of Edmonton, our vision is that all students will gain the knowledge, skills and attitudes to be dedicated, self-reliant, responsible, contributing members of society.The PositionThe successful candidate must be a self-directed team player who is interested in providing support and encouragement to students with a diversity of learning needs.Hours of work will be Monday through Friday, beginning at 7:30 a.m. by assisting the student on the bus trip to the school, continue through the day by assisting the student in the school and conclude by assisting the student on the return bus trip home, ending at 5:00 p.m.Duties are to commence August 30, 2021.Qualifications:Ability to work with students who require behaviour supportsAbility to work with students with limited formal languageFlexible, patient and understands children with diverse needsExcellent interpersonal and communication skills with students and adultsApplicants should be willing to work with a team of support staff and willing to be flexible in their assignmentsEnthusiastic and motivated to help students succeedFirst aid would be an assetFor further information, please contact:Wayne Rufiange (Principal) at 780-349-4454This competition closes: July 25, 2021 at 4:00 p.m.Apply at : https://pembinahills.simplication.com/If you require assistance with the application process, please call Simplication @ 1-877-900-5627PLEASE NOTE:Your resume should include a list of references with permission for Pembina Hills School Division to contact any or all references.Original Criminal Record Check including Vulnerable Sector (dated within one year) must be provided prior to employment.Original Intervention Record Check (dated within one year) – issued by Child & Family Services Authority must be provided prior to employment.Verification of Education and relative experience is required.We thank all applicants for their interest.
